A Support Group can be defined as a gathering of people with common experiences and concerns who meet together to provide emotional and moral support for one another. They encourage a sense of community, a source of empathetic understanding and provide an avenue for establishing social networks.

Leadership Options for group leadership include professionally-led (by a treatment provider), peer-led (by someone with the disorder or someone affected by the disorder, such as a parent or caregiver), or a combination of the two. Leadership can also rotate if need be.

A support group provides an opportunity for people to share personal experiences and feelings, coping strategies, or firsthand ...Setting up a support group would seem a fairly simple task—find a room, set a time to meet, decide if the group will be facilitated or self-run by survivors, put out the cookies and chairs, and send out the flyers. Creating emotional safety in a support group is quite another matter and deserves specific attention.Facilitated groups can provide a nonjudgmental framework for caregivers to find understanding and support from others who are in similar situations.
